2. Windows XL Driver 2-5 Output Tab s Copies Specifies the number of prints to be made. Select between 1 and 999 copies by clicking on the arrows at the right of the field or by typing the desired number directly into the field. The factory default setting is "1". s Collate When you are printing more than one copy of one or more pages, it is possible to sort the printed copy sets. *It is necessary to create a RAM disk. (Refer to "RAM disk" on page 2-7) Example: If the "Collate" option is selected, it is possible to print out 2 sets of the same copies. 2-6
